CVE-2013-7245
The CVE-2013-7245 issue affects SAP Sybase ASE 15.7 Backup Server component prior to SP51. The root cause is a failure to validate credentials, allowing remote attackers to bypass access restrictions and perform database dumps. CVE-2017-14177
Apport through 2.20.7 does not properly handle core dumps from setuid binaries allowing local users to create certain files as root which an attacker could leverage to perform a denial of service via resource exhaustion or possibly gain root privileges. ProcDump for Linux - A Linux version of the ProcDump Sysinternals tool
ProcDump is a Linux reimagining of the classic ProcDump tool from the Sysinternals suite of tools for Windows.
